This Dobbies is pretty good, it has a large plant selection and this time of year (spring) it has a great vegetable plant and seed selection. It 's all reasonably priced, though some things can be quite expensive. Sadly the pet/fish dept is now closed, this always stood this garden apart from the others. Likewise the 'shopping village ' was always canny, but it 's a shadow of what it was, hardly worth the effort. There is a Waitrose in store now, which is handy but pricey. As a garden centre this place is great and would likely have everything you want, as its the larger of the dobbies in the area. There car park is large, and there is an overflow but still gets busy. There is a well stocked fruit and veg shop outside the exit door, with some excellent produce. Oh, almost forget the dinosaur crazy golf for the kids, which costs, but isn 't extorniate. Overall, I recommend it.
